In the Philippines, same-sex marriages and civil unions are still not recognized legally, and go against the country’s Family Code. Quezon City, however, has chosen to celebrate everyone with their annual Commitment Ceremony for LGBTQ couples. The event, part of the city’s goal to “provide a place where every member of the community is well-respected and treated equally,” is officiated by Mayor Joy Belmonte. Couples can register for the event until January 30th.
